Cross Country – Gangwarily

Just before the Easter break, our Year 3 and 4’s took part in a Cross Country event at Gangwarily and for once it wasn’t raining! Well done to the Year 3 girls team who placed 9th out of 24 teams with personal performances from Katie (9th), Megan (29th) and Ava (48th) out of 93 runners. The Year 3 boys teams who came 5thand 15th out of 30 teams with solid team performances from Timothy (14th), Charlie (18th) and Austin (22nd) out of 94 runners.
The Year 4 girls needed 3 runners to have a team placing, but super individual performances from Maddie (12th) and Freya (13th) out of 88 other competitors. The boys in Year 4 ran well too, with a standout run from Bertie placing 22nd out of a huge field of 91 runners.
Mrs Dallyn was so proud of all the children who took part. She was particularly impressed with how confident they were in front of many other competitors and spectators. They listened well, followed all instructions, supported each other showing superb sportsmanship and respect for one another. It was lovely to see them cheering each other spectacularly from the side lines and every runner displayed true grit, determination, resilience, and courage.
